Quick note before the sync: Fernwick now supports hot-reloading of config. Push a new TOML blob to the /config/reload endpoint and the daemon picks it up within five seconds — no restart, no dropped connections. Validation runs first, so a bad file just gets rejected and logged. To try it against staging, you'll need to authenticate with the Fernwick control-plane key, which is pasted below.

gateway credential: vxb4-QTMv

# Service Accounts — Hermetic Build Migration

As part of migrating the Larkspur monorepo to the Sealbox hermetic build system, all remote cache and artifact fetches now run under dedicated service accounts rather than developer identities. Contractors should use the `sealbox-migrator` account for cache seeding tasks only; it cannot publish release artifacts. Requests for broader scopes go through the Gatewright review queue. When configuring your local Sealbox client to talk to the remote cache, authenticate with the key below.

service key, fawip-bajef: kto11_Qt5wZK9vdNC

Heads up for whoever touches this next: the sweeper in Driftwell now walks the whole resource graph before deleting anything, so orphans with dangling parents don't get nuked prematurely. It's slower, but we stopped eating data on the Karvo cluster, so worth it. If sweep latency creeps up, don't just crank the batch size — adjust these knobs together, since they interact.

constants for hahip-hafog:
WEIGHTS = {
    "feniel": 55,
    "kasox": 667,
}

Plugin authors: the Gullwing collector compresses telemetry payloads before forwarding them upstream. Compression is applied per batch, not per event, so undersized batches waste CPU for negligible savings. If your plugin emits fewer than roughly two hundred events per flush, consider raising your flush interval rather than disabling compression. Never change the codec at runtime; the decompressor on the aggregation tier is pinned. All compression behavior is governed by the values that follow.

deployment values, yadug-bawif:
[framir]
team = pelox
access_code = ac_a38ab2
owner = tamion.julael
host = framir.tolvaqlabs.test
port = 11211
peer = tammir.zemvargrid.local
salt = 2215ef03
pin = 1541